AFC Bournemouth vs Liverpool: form, goals and key statistics

Game details

AFC Bournemouth plays Liverpool in Premier League (England). The game is scheduled for September 20, 2026. Venue: Vitality Stadium.

Recent form

AFC Bournemouth has 0 wins, 3 draws and 1 loss over its last five games, averaging 0.75 points per game. Liverpool has 1 win, 3 draws and 0 losses, with 1.50 points per game.

Scoring records

AFC Bournemouth scores 1.50 goals per game and allows 1.75. Liverpool scores 1.50 and allows 1.00. Games in this league average 2.85 goals.

BTTS and goal totals

Both teams score in 100% of AFC Bournemouth's games and 50% of Liverpool's. The Over 2.5 rates are 75% and 50%, compared with league averages of 53% for BTTS and 53% for Over 2.5.

xG and shots

Liverpool has the higher season xG average, 1.85 to 1.61 per game. AFC Bournemouth takes 14.8 shots per game, while Liverpool takes 16.0.

First-half and second-half trends

AFC Bournemouth leads at halftime in 75% of its games and scores 0.25 goals per game after halftime. Liverpool leads at halftime in 25% and scores 1.00 after halftime.

When the teams score

AFC Bournemouth's most productive scoring window is minutes 31-45+ (3 goals). For Liverpool, it is minutes 0-15 (2 goals). These are past scoring patterns, not predicted goal times.

League scoring profile

Premier League games average 2.85 goals. Both teams score in 53% of games, and 53% finish with at least three goals.

Head-to-head record

Before this game, 2 previous meetings were available. The record was 1 home win, 0 draws and 1 away win. Those games averaged 5.50 goals, with both teams scoring in 100% of them.
